Personal Details of Cara Whitney

To give a clearer picture of Cara Whitney, here are some key pieces of information about her, as gathered from various sources. This helps, in some respects, to round out the portrait of a person who is more than just a famous spouse.

Full NameCara Whitney
Year of Birth1976
NationalityAmerican
Known ForRadio DJ, Author, Wife of Larry the Cable Guy
SpouseDaniel Lawrence Whitney (Larry the Cable Guy)
Marriage Year2005
ChildrenWyatt (son), Reagan (daughter)
Estimated Net WorthOver $1 million (her own, likely shares more with husband)

Their Children and Shared Experiences

Larry the Cable Guy and Cara Whitney are the proud parents of two children. Their son, Wyatt, was born on August 2, 2006. A little over a year later, their daughter, Reagan, arrived on October 29, 2007. These birth dates, you know, mark the expansion of their family unit, bringing new dimensions to their lives as a couple.

The family has, on occasion, appeared in public, offering a glimpse into their shared experiences. For instance, Daniel Whitney, known as Larry the Cable Guy, and Cara, along with their children Wyatt and Reagan, were featured in an issue of People magazine. At the time of that particular article, Larry was 45, Cara was 31, their daughter Reagan was 4 months old, and their son Wyatt was 19 months old. This appearance, in some respects, allowed the public to see them as a family, discussing aspects of their life together.
